Ministry Advises Pilgrims to Prepare for Hajj 2027 Registration
Image: propakistani.pk

Pakistan's Ministry of Religious Affairs has told intending pilgrims to get ready for Hajj 2027 registration, which is expected to open soon. The ministry says registration will be required for both government and private schemes, with no fee for the registration step.

Analysis

The Ministry of Religious Affairs and Interfaith Harmony says Saudi Arabia has already begun preparations for Hajj 2027 and has asked member countries to start pilgrim registration early. Pakistan's ministry says it will announce the registration process later this month.

Registration will be mandatory for everyone intending to perform Hajj under either the government or private scheme. The ministry also says overseas Pakistanis will be eligible to register. Officials clarified that no fee will be charged for registration itself, which suggests the step is meant as an advance intake process rather than a payment stage.

A key requirement is a Pakistani machine-readable passport. People who do not already have one have been advised to obtain it as soon as possible. The passport must remain valid until November 16, 2027, which gives applicants a clear document deadline to meet before the pilgrimage cycle.

The ministry said the full expenses and other terms for Hajj 2027 will be announced later under the Hajj Policy 2027. For now, the main takeaway is preparation: prospective pilgrims should secure the right passport and watch the ministry's official website for the registration announcement and policy details.
